The concert features the music of Glenn Miller, Count Basie, Tommy Dorsey, Quincy Jones, Billy May, Frank Sinatra, Ella Fitzgerald and many more.

Founded in 1967 by trumpeter and arranger Syd Lawrence, the orchestra has been thrilling audiences all over the UK and Europe for over 40 years.

The orchestra has been directed by Chris Dean since Syd’s retirement in 1996 and currently has a repertoire of more than 1,200 classic Big Band titles.

Since taking the reins Chris has worked to increase the number of young musicians playing Big Band Swing. Some of today’s finest young jazz musicians form part of the orchestra, which has meant rave reviews and plenty of sold-out shows.
